Foundation Overview
Based in West Palm Beach, FL, Three Opinions Foundation Inc has awarded 112 grants totaling $3,094,261 to organizations in New York, Virginia and 13 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$10 to $200,000, with a median award of $1,030.

Geographic Focus
48% of grants are awarded in Florida, with additional funding distributed across 14 other locations. The foundation balances regional focus with broader geographic diversity. Within Florida, funding concentrates in West Palm Beach (46%), Miami (28%), Palm Beach (19%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
